From outside they look just like regular lock but when opened you'll see a little piece of silicone on both halves of the clips. It creates friction between lock and bracelet, the nice thing is that you can put them where ever you want and as many as you want.

We have some on our site.
 
But would the silicone damage the color of the leather? Or change when wet, like when you wash your hands?
Not sure what you are thinking of, but silicone is a solid, like rubber, it can't change the color and nothing would happen if it got wet. It would be like putting a rubber/elastic band around some leather - it doesn't change it in any way.
 
Hi,

I'm using something similair on my leather bracelet. I have some beads that look like spacers, but have silicone rings on the inside and you slide them on the bracelet. I have the double leather bracelet and use them to keep some beads on the first loop of the leather and some beads on the second. I don't fear the silicone damaging anything.
